Nettet17. feb. 2024 · Box 122: Commission income (loss) (multi-jurisdictional) – Enter this amount at amount 5A of Form T2125 and report the income on line 13900 of your T1 return. The gross amount is in box 123. Box 123: Gross commission income (multi-jurisdictional) – Enter this amount on line 13899 of your T1 return.
